Which term describes awareness and management of one's own thinking and learning processes?

Explanation:
Metacognition is awareness of how you think and learn, along with the ability to plan, monitor, and adjust your thinking as you work. This includes recognizing when you understand something and when you don’t, deciding which strategies to use, and changing approaches if you’re not making progress. That combination of understanding your own thinking and actively guiding it to improve learning is what makes metacognition the best description here. For contrast, digital citizenship focuses on responsible and safe use of technology; a simile is a figure of speech that compares two things using like or as; a prefix is a word part added to the beginning of a word to change its meaning.
